RUGBY: Wins for Newbold and Lions
There were just a couple of competitive first team games on Saturday, with only Newbold and Lions in action.
At Parkfield Road, Newbold had the narrowest of victories, 18-17 against Huntingdon & District. Unbeaten Newbold stay top of Midlands 1 East, four points ahead of nearest rivals Old Northamptonians. Huntingdon are seventh.
This weekend Newbold travel to 13th placed Ilkeston.

This Saturday’s game sees the unbeaten Midlands 2 West (South) leaders back in league action, hosting fourth-placed Berkswell & Balsall at Webb Ellis Road.
Lions are six points clear at the top on 43 points, with Silhillians second on 37, with Spartans and Berkswell & Balsall both on 34.
Old Laurentians welcome Oakham to Fenley Field on Saturday, for a Midlands 2 East (South) fixture. In this very tight division OLs are third on 32 points and Oakham fourth with 31. Leaders Peterborough have 36 points and second placed Oundle 33.

Rugby Welsh also face their top-of-the-table side Burbage in Midlands 5 West (South) this weekend. Burbage have 39 points from eight wins out of eight. Welsh are fourth on 14.
